  • Abstract
    This paper gives a description of a new algorithm for preemption to be used in MPLS networks. It enables allocation of enabled network resources for a new path at the cost of removing one or more of the existing paths. The heuristic algorithm presented here selects paths to be removed, by using topology information. The method is based on an optimization function to achieve low band-width wastage on a network scale
